Output dbdebfa5b520b3bd74f877dc5e7ac0ba2952d6150f84b9b095cfc7df4f55e839:1

value
306332
script pubkey
OP_0 OP_PUSHBYTES_20 b32f551664f0b9c24969087f4941314ecd0fea9b
address
bc1qkvh429ny7zuuyjtfppl5jsf3fmxsl65m57jfv0
transaction
dbdebfa5b520b3bd74f877dc5e7ac0ba2952d6150f84b9b095cfc7df4f55e839
spent
true